Frequently Asked Questions about New Louisville Apartments

What is the Cheapest New apartment in Louisville?

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Louisville is at The Prestonian listed at $543.

How much is the average rent for a New Louisville Apartment?

The average rent for a New Apartment in Louisville is $1,679.

What is the largest New Louisville Apartment for rent?

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Louisville is a 2,349 square feet unit starting from $3,150 at Bull Run Townhomes.

What is the average size for Louisville New Apartments for rent?

The average size for a New rental in Louisville is currently at 713 sq ft.
